About The Position

The EVS Tech cleans and services all areas of the building, to include all off-site facilities, moves furniture, equipment, and supplies throughout the hospital departments according to established procedures. He/She will perform a variety of services to maintain the hospital in a neat, orderly, and sanitary condition. Reports to: Director of Environmental Services

Responsibilities

  • Clean assigned areas by washing furniture, tile, fixtures, vents, patient television and windows using germicidal solution.
  • Sweep and mop floor areas, dust and damp mop patient rooms, vacuum carpets, and spot clean carpet.
  • Clean all blinds, window curtains, and cubicle curtains in all patient rooms (including isolation room).
  • Operate various types of cleaning equipments, both mechanical and electrical.
  • Select cleaning material and supplies/prepare germicidal solutions according to procedures.
  • Load service carts and transport to work area.
  • Clean all bathrooms, (patient, private, public) disinfecting all fixtures, floors and walls as directed.
  • Clean mirrors and replenish bathroom supplies.
  • Collect waste from all areas of the hospital and sanitize all trash cans.
  • Collect hazardous waste as established by Infection Control Committee.
  • Transport all hazardous waste to pick up area.
  • Perform terminal cleaning of patient rooms as quickly as possible to avoid long waits for the next patient, assuring everything is sanitized by notifying nurse is ready for occupation.
  • Clean movable furniture and stationery furnishings.
  • Clean all shelves and ledges.
  • Return all unused supplies to supply room, clean carts, and equipment.
  • Ensure all items are replaced in an orderly manner.
  • Notify team lead when supply levels are low and when equipment needs repair.
  • Transport clean linens and remove soiled linens from departments.
  • Replenish linen closet.
  • Hospital laundry special itmes in washer and dryer on premises, such as cleaning clothes, mop heads, pillow covers and restraints.
  • Fold and deliver to department.
